Action item from the Pruneling incident (stale-branch cleanup bot). Root cause: bot deleted branches with open review threads because the grace window was shorter than the review SLA. Fix shipped. New members: never lower the grace window below the review SLA. Dry-run mode is default in staging; verify before promoting. Alerting now fires if deletions exceed the hourly cap. All thresholds live in one config module, reviewed quarterly. Memorize the defaults so anomalies stand out. The current constants are listed below.

tuning table, kajog-kawef:
PRIORITIES = {
    "kelox": 870,
    "kasix": 89,
    "eliax": 988,
}

# Break-Glass: Catalog Cache Invalidation

Scope: the Pinrow product catalog at Veldstone Retail. If stale prices persist after a purge and the Hollowmere invalidation queue is wedged, use break-glass to flush the edge tier directly. Contractors: get verbal sign-off from the catalog lead first. Steps: open the Hollowmere admin shell, select emergency-flush, confirm the tenant, and run it once — repeated flushes thrash the origin. Access is logged and expires after 20 minutes. Unseal the admin shell with the passphrase below.

recovery phrase for kahop-tajog: istix-casvan

# Basement Archive Room — Night Access

The archive room under Pellworth House holds old contracts and the tape backups. Night shift: take stairwell C, not the lift (it's switched off after midnight). Lights are on a timer by the door — slap the button as you go in. Sign the logbook, even at 3am, yes really. The keypad by the door takes the code below.

staff pass of fahap-tajeg = bdg-FT-6

Ticket #— Floor 9 Opening Prep, Brindlemoor House

Hi facilities folks, Floor 9 opens to staff next Monday and we need a few things squared away before then. Lift access is live, but the two side doors by the kitchenette are still on the old lock config — please reprogram them before Friday. Also, signage for the quiet rooms hasn't arrived, so pop up the temporary printed ones for now. Until the badge readers sync, the interim door code for Floor 9 is below.

door code, bajop-bajog: bdg-DSWAC-43621